Job Summary

Conduct indirect and direct patient care within the Medical Assisting scope, including measuring vital signs, administering medications, and preparing patients for examination rooms. Document patient needs and chief complaints in electronic medical records, manage in-basket messages, and assist with virtual health visits by pre-charting and troubleshooting issues. Maintain a safe environment by keeping work areas clean, ensuring proper equipment function, and disposing of contaminated supplies. Show patients to exam rooms and perform front desk workflows such as scheduling, phone triage, and check-in/check-out. Follow up on orders, appointments, and referrals while collecting co-pays as needed.

Required Qualifications

  • Active Medical Assisting certification from one of the following: Certified Medical Assistant (CMA); American Association of Medical Assisting Registered Medical Assistant (RMA); American Medical Technologists Certified Clinical Medical Assistant (CCMA); National Healthcareer Association (NHA) Nationally Certified Medical Assistant (NCMA); National Center for Competency Testing (NCCT) Nationally Registered Certified Medical Assistant (NRCMA); National Association for Health Professionals (NAH...
  • If incumbent is unable to obtain MA certification, an Assessment-Based Recognition in Order Entry (ABR-OE) is acceptable (not accepted in the state of South Carolina)
  • BLS Basic Life Support, American Heart Association (required at hire for Roper St Francis Healthcare locations)
  • High School/GED
  • Completion of an accredited Medical Assistant post-secondary education program (preferred in all states except South Carolina)
  • In South Carolina: An accredited Medical assistant post-secondary education program
  • In South Carolina: A Career and technical education health sciences program approved by the South Carolina Department of Education
  • In South Carolina: A medical assisting program provided by a branch of the United States military
  • In South Carolina: A Medical assisting United States Department of Labor approved Registered Apprenticeship program
  • In South Carolina: A Training program that is delivered, in whole or in part, by a health care employer that aligns to a nationally accredited certification exam
  • Completion of externship or clinical lab training (preferred)
  • 1 year of recent Medical Assisting experience (preferred)
